Beiersdorf Aktiengesellschaft, trading in the United States under the symbol BDRFY, is a German consumer goods company specializing in skin care and adhesive technologies. Founded in Hamburg in 1882, Beiersdorf has grown into a global player in personal care, developing and marketing products designed to maintain and restore skin health. The company’s core business segments encompass consumer skin care, medical skin care, and tesa adhesive technologies, serving both retail and professional customers.

In its consumer skin care division, Beiersdorf is best known for its flagship NIVEA brand, one of the world’s leading skin care names.
